Hyperbaric Technician II PRN
Job Summary
The Hyperbaric Technologist, under the direction of the Director of the Outpatient Wound Care Department, administers hyperbaric oxygen therapy to patients as prescribed by the Hyperbaric Physician.
Required Knowledge and Skills
- Basic Cardiac Life Support must be obtained within 30 days of employment start date
- Familiarity with physical gas laws and formulas
- Demonstrated competency for Chamber Operation - Pressurization, Treatment, Decompression, cleaning, inspection, maintenance, daily quality log documentation, TCPO2 Testing
- Tolerance for pressurization and depressurization in a hyperbaric chamber (Multiplace Only)
- Familiarity with Multiplace Emergency Procedures
- Familiarity with the chamber system layout and complex components
